Two men have been charged by police after a red telephone box was blown up with a firework.
A 20-year-old man from Lockleaze and an 18-year-old from Cadbury Heath are due to appear before Bristol Magistrates' Court on Saturday.
The pair are charged with criminal damage likely to endanger life. An 18-year-old man has appeared in court over the same offence.
The explosion in Warmley, near Bristol, on Sunday completely destroyed the box.
Debris was scattered over a 100m radius.
A third man, aged 27, has been bailed pending further inquiries.
